What Is One UI?
For those unfamiliar, One UI is Samsung’s proprietary interface designed to make the Android experience more intuitive, visually appealing, and accessible. Its core principles of clarity and simplicity align perfectly with the mission of ECOIN Wallet. With this latest update, ECOIN Wallet has fully adopted the One UI 8 guidelines, ensuring that the cryptocurrency experience is as refined as that of a flagship device.

Previously operating on One UI 7, ECOIN Wallet now transitions to One UI 8. This upgrade enhances every user interaction with sophisticated blur effects, updated bottom sheet spacing, and a responsiveness that establishes a new benchmark for Web3 applications.
What's New
- •Full UI alignment with One UI 8 guidelines.
- •New Bottom Sheets styled according to One UI 8, featuring blur, transparency, and refined padding.
- •New closing animations for bottom sheets.
- •New QR Code Scanner with One UI styling and flashlight control.
- •Trending Tokens page for real-time market movement tracking.
- •Fully Themable App that adapts to your device’s color palette.
- •Predictive animations for the keyboard and search bar.
- •New API for fetching token transactions, utilizing Moralis.
- •New dedicated changelog bottom sheet.
- •Libraries & Gradle fully updated for maximum stability.

The QR Scanner has been completely rebuilt using Google ML Kit, enabling it to function effectively in low-light conditions and handle dark-mode WalletConnect codes with ease. Users can now import QR codes directly from their gallery or files. This enhanced scanner is up to 5x faster and significantly more reliable.
The application is now fully palette-themable, dynamically adjusting to your device’s color scheme for a more cohesive visual experience. Furthermore, all modals have been refined with proper alpha, blur effects, and improved padding, resulting in cleaner visuals, enhanced depth, and an overall smoother, more modern interface.

Additionally, the Trending Tokens feature has been introduced. Users can now monitor market activity across BNB Chain, Ethereum, Polygon, and Base without leaving the app. The feature allows filtering by timeframe, checking market capitalization, or performing swaps directly from the trending list, offering simplified DeFi intelligence.

Bug Fixes and Improvements
- •Fixed Stellar (XLM) transfer issues.
- •Fixed rendering of rounded corners in transaction bottom items.
- •Fixed advanced approval modal issues.
- •Fixed missing token icon on the Transfer Activity header.
- •Fixed infinite loading issue on BNB transactions.
- •Fixed incorrect "FROM" address display after receiving a transaction.
- •Fixed Swaps Wrap/Unwrap issues.
- •Added missing Polygon Amoy Assets.
- •QR code scans now automatically expand input fields for long wallet addresses.
- •Housekeeping: Updated all dependencies, libraries, and frameworks, including Gradle, Kotlin, KSP, and Room.
